The Level 3 Award in Education and Training (QCF) is an introductory teaching qualification which prepares learners for teaching or training in a wide range of contexts. It does not develop competence, as learners are not required to be in a teaching position.There are three theory Units which will be assessed through three written assignments: - Understanding roles, responsibilities and relationships in education and training - Understanding and using inclusive learning and teaching approaches in education and training - Understanding assessment in education and training There is also one practical Unit: - A 30 minute micro teach on a subject of your choice In addition, you will be required to write a Reflective Learning Journal after each of the above Units to evaluate what you have learned and how it will impact on your practice.
